Secular Concert All Voicings medium-easy
l Through the Eyes of the MoonCynthia Gray.
This simple yet poignant reflection on the inherent
beauty of all humanity and the earth itself is framed
in beautiful, flowing melodic lines. A gentle, pensive
accompaniment showcases the thought-provoking
text of this creative concert or festival original.
The two-part edition was commissioned for the
Cincinnati Children's Choir Festival. "Rising through
the darkness on a cloud of dreams and mist, my
eyes gazed upon the earth. Sapphire and white, like
a jewel in the night, earth was beautiful through the
eyes of the moon."

H Velvet ShoesRandall Thompson. This is a
stunning setting of the famous winter poem by
Elinor Wylie. "Let us walk in the white snow in a
soundless space; with footsteps quiet and slow, at
a tranquil pace, under veils of white lace..." The
choral parts sing easily, and the piano interludes
add their own winter imagery between verses.
A reflective selection that will be a beautifully
expressive moment in your concert!

4 Viva! (from "Il re pastore")W.A. Mozart/
arr. Patrick M. Liebergen. A triumphant Mozart
masterwork for today's choirs! This joyful opera
finale opens and closes with a boisterous choral
fanfare that features a brief, expressive vocal duet
in the middle. The text is in Italian with optional
English translation and IPA pronunciation guide
included. The choral parts are supported by an
exciting piano accompaniment for an arrangement
that remains true to the original while being
accessible to school choirs. Not necessarily familiar,
but undeniably fantastic!

We Will Sing the World Whole AgainMark
Burrows. This song begins by having choir members
state something hurtful that has been said to them
in an overlapping texture that shows that we have
all been affected by pain and violence, and yet
we choose to sing. From its opening section of
cacophony to the powerful refrain, this original song
will inspire your singers and your audience to rise
above their hurt and the violence in our world. "We
will rise from the senseless pain and violence. Fear
will fail and love will win. And a new song will echo
in the silence. We will sing the world whole again."

4 What Do the Stars Do?Victor C. Johnson. A
delicate piano introduction leads the listener to an
elegant setting of Christina Rossetti's inquisitive
poem. Well-conceived voice-leading makes the
fully realized choral harmony beautifully singable,
and each voice part gets a turn with the melody.
Text painting, lyrical lines, warm suspensions, and
emotional range make this a wonderful teaching
piece for musicality and phrasing. Get ready to
amaze audiences and adjudicators with this highly
recommended piece.

STRATEGIC
PLANS FOR A
SUCCESSFUL
BOOSTER CLUB
Time-Tested Concepts
for Breaking rough
to the Next Level
David W. Vandewalker.
This book is the companion resource
to Boosters to the Rescue! which
provides ready-to-use Word, Excel,
and PDF files to help booster clubs
set and achieve a long-term vision
for their organization. Strategic Plans
includes project planning guides
for three diverse sizes of booster
clubs: Developing, Growing, and
Maximizing. Strategic Plans offers a
wealth of ideas, forms, organizational
charts, and branding tools in four
concise sections. Ready, Set, and
Go! introduces the strategic planning
process and explains how to start.
Rally the Troops provides practical
advice on how to organize, manage,
and empower people. Roll It Out
creates a business plan blueprint
and a project planning guide, and
Rock It Out includes ways to build
effective teams. An invaluable
resource for every music leader who
wants to create a community of
support around the important task of
educating young musicians.

WARM-UPS
FOR CHANGING
VOICES
Building Healthy Habits
for Middle School Singers
Dan Andersen. As any middle
school choir director knows, change
is the name of the game! A changing
voice is just one of countless
physiological and emotional
changes that middle school students
experience. Knowing the general
limits of male and female changing
voices, as well as the specific
capabilities of your students, are
two keys to building healthy and
happy middle school singers. This
book is an accessible must-read
resource for any middle school choir
director looking to foster stronger,
more capable musicians. It offers
25 warm-up exercises along with
customized grade-specific tips for
using them, along with free access to
accompanying audio recordings.
